Luke 8:52

KJV

And all wept, and bewailed her: but he said, Weep not; she is not dead, but sleepeth.

— Luke 8:52, King James Version

ASV

And all were weeping, and bewailing her: but he said, Weep not; for she is not dead, but sleepeth.

YLT

and they were all weeping, and beating themselves for her, and he said, `Weep not, she did not die, but doth sleep;

BBE

And all the people were weeping and crying for her; but he said, Do not be sad, for she is not dead, but sleeping.
